Property Details for 8 Somerset Rd, Coromandel Valley

8 Somerset Rd, Coromandel Valley is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 1 parking spaces and was built in 1965. The property has a land size of 1515m2 and floor size of 153m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in November 2022.

About Coromandel Valley 5051

The size of Coromandel Valley is approximately 4.3 square kilometres. It has 18 parks covering nearly 7.9% of total area. The population of Coromandel Valley in 2016 was 4201 people. By 2021 the population was 4380 showing a population growth of 4.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Coromandel Valley is 40-49 years. Households in Coromandel Valley are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Coromandel Valley work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 92.00% of the homes in Coromandel Valley were owner-occupied compared with 90.50% in 2016.

Coromandel Valley has 1,733 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Coromandel Valley have seen a 87.84%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 9.12% increase. As at 31 January 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Coromandel Valley is $1,132,512 while the median value for Units is $365,988.
  • Houses have a median rent of $650.
